Analysis

Indonesia recorded 1.1% for chlorophyll-a deviation from the global average in 2022.

Compared with earlier readings it is down 27.5% on the previous year and down 38.0% over ten years.

Over the whole period, chlorophyll-a deviation from the global average in Indonesia peaked at 7.9% in 2006 and was at its lowest, 0.9%, in 2016.

That places Indonesia 111th out of 193 countries with data for 2022, putting it in the middle of the range.

The series is highly variable year to year, so single readings are best treated with caution.
